What is an impact window?

An impact window is a specially designed window built to withstand extreme weather conditions. It features a strong frame and a laminated glass layer that holds together even when broken, preventing dangerous shards from scattering and protecting against high winds and debris.

What are the drawbacks of impact windows?

While impact windows offer superior protection, potential drawbacks include a higher initial cost compared to standard windows. Some homeowners may also find the tinting or slight distortion in older laminated glass styles noticeable. However, modern options largely mitigate these concerns.

What is the highest rated impact window?

The highest-rated impact windows are those that meet or exceed stringent industry testing standards for wind resistance and projectile impact. Look for certifications like Miami-Dade compliance, which is a recognized benchmark for severe weather performance.
